Job Description (General description of job, issues affecting job functions)
We are looking for a Sr. UI Developer who is motivated to combine the art of
design with the art of HTML5 & CSS3, Scripting. Responsibilities will include translation of the UI/UX design wireframes to actual code that will produce visual elements of the application.
The candidate will work with the UI/UX designer and bridge the gap between
graphical design and technical implementation, taking an active role on both
sides and defining how the application looks as well as how it works.
Role (Specific tasks and the role that the person will undertake)
- Responsible to create responsive design and code using cutting edge technology like HTML5, CSS3, Sass and Less JavaScript and JQuery.
- Develop new user-facing features
- Build reusable code and libraries for future use
- Ensure the technical feasibility of UI/UX designs
- Optimize application for maximum speed and scalability
- Follow architecture principles and development standards set by the team to deliver high quality user interface code that will run across multiple browsers with high performance.
- Good understanding of typography, layout and color theory and should be able to show previous work that is truly innovative and on target.
- Assure that all user input is validated before submitting to back-end
- Collaborate with other team members and stakeholders
- Make sure projects are delivered on time.
Experience (Relevant must have experience)
- 6+ years of relevant technical or professional experience
- Experience in UI/Web based development using Angular.js for standalone and high-volume web applications.
Job-related Skills (Technical & professional skills that the person must have to be effective)
- Proficient understanding of web markup, including HTML5, CSS3
- Basic understanding of server-side CSS pre-processing platforms, such as LESS and SASS
- Proficient understanding of client-side scripting and JavaScript frameworks, including jQuery
- Better understanding of designs elements.
- Knowledge of usability and browser compatibility issues.
Management/Personal Skills (Non-technical and managerial skills
- Excellent verbal and written Communication skills
- Ability to integrate with knowledge workers
- Mindset to collaborate in team-working class
Education (Specific areas that must be applied to candidates; prior certification that theymay need)
- MCA/BE or equivalent with advance English level is required
- Even high potential well qualified technical graduates can be considered